United Site Services Company Profile
Background
Overview
United Site Services (USS) is the nation's leading provider of portable sanitation services and complementary site solutions, offering a comprehensive range of equipment and services to meet the diverse needs of its clients. Established in 1999, the company has grown to become a significant player in the site services industry, serving various sectors including construction, industrial, government, agriculture, emergency response, and special events.

Financials and Funding
Funding History
USS has undergone significant financial restructuring to strengthen its balance sheet and position the company for accelerated growth. In March 2026, the company completed a comprehensive financial recapitalization, which included:
- Reducing its funded debt level by $2.4 billion
- Infusing the company with new capital, including:
- $480 million in new equity financing
- $300 million in new-money term loans
- A $195 million ABL credit facility
- A separate $100 million revolving credit facility
This recapitalization was confirmed by the U.S. Bankruptcy Court on February 27, 2026, and was designed to enhance the company's financial flexibility and resources to deliver high-quality services to its customers.
